What Exactly Is Acoustics?
The term “acoustics” is familiar to several people in describing the sound transmission qualities of buildings, but in scientific terms, there is slightly more than that. So what does it truly imply and how are acoustics utilized?
As a broad concept, “acoustics” is the science of sound. When utilized to describe the building qualities, the term addresses the way in which sound echo, or bounce back, or the degree to which they can be dampened to prevent echo when necessary. It is an extensively utilized term among musicians and their audiences to describe the amount of echo and hence sound quality in a practice room, recording studio or a performance venue.
Nonetheless, while at its core the scientific definition of “acoustics” maintains this meaning concerning the sound transmission, its uses are much extensive than this, and varied. Acoustics are specifically relevant to noise control, for instance, and also having uses in fields as mechanics, engineering, audiology, Oceanography, and the study of seismic waves.
Acoustics in use
In music, acoustics are applicable in the ...
... production and use of instruments and the sound qualities of performance rooms, and in this sense, the term is relevant both in respect to artistic abilities and architecture and how performances are delivered and accepted.
In engineering, acoustics are taken into consideration in the study of noise and shock in sonic and ultrasonic engineering, impacting the construction of building and mechanical projects both small and large.
In the world of science, acoustics are utilized to measure the seismic activity and in underwater situation in measuring the geological activity of the seafloor and in navigating submarines.
In the health and life sciences, classroom acoustics are specifically relevant to speech and communication sciences, audiology and the development of medical device like ultrasound scanners.
